    Amkor Technology, Inc. (NASDAQ:AMKR) reported $0.09 EPS for the quarter, beating the Thomson Reuters consensus estimate of $0.03 by $0.06. The company had revenue of $696.00 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$678.13 million.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company posted $0.07 earnings per share. The company’s quarterly revenue was up 1.2% on a year-over-year basis. Analysts expect that Amkor Technology will post $0.70 EPS for the current fiscal year. Amkor Technology, Inc. (NASDAQ:AMKR) shares fell -2.63% in last trading session and ended the day on $10.75. AMKR Gross Margin is 19.00% and its return on assets is 3.70%. Amkor Technology, Inc. (NASDAQ:AMKR) quarterly performance is 76.52%.

    JetBlue Airways Corporation (NASDAQ:JBLU) reported $0.01 EPS for the quarter, missing the Thomson Reuters consensus estimate of $0.09 by $0.08. The company had revenue of $1.30 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.38 billion.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company posted $0.05 earnings per share. The company’s quarterly revenue was up 3.8% on a year-over-year basis. On average, analysts predict that JetBlue Airways Corp. will post $0.68 earnings per share for the current fiscal year. JetBlue Airways Corporation (NASDAQ:JBLU) shares moved up 2.53% in last trading session and was closed at $10.54, while trading in range of $10.28 – $10.58. JetBlue Airways Corporation (NASDAQ:JBLU) year to date (YTD) performance is 23.42%.

    Avis Budget Group Inc. (NASDAQ:CAR) announced that its wholly-owned subsidiary, Avis Budget Car Rental, LLC, has completed an offering of $400 million aggregate principal amount of 5.125% senior notes due 2022. Avis Budget Group Inc. (NASDAQ:CAR) ended the last trading day at $60.05. Company weekly volatility is calculated as 2.96% and price to cash ratio as 7.53. Avis Budget Group Inc. (NASDAQ:CAR) showed a positive weekly performance of 4.93%.
